New truck. Already S#!tting out on me
I just bought a 2008 f150 extended cab 4x4 with a 4.6 and 140k and I believe my a/c compressor is bad, because when I turn it on at idle the whole freaking truck shakes. What's weird is it doesn't do this every time the a/c is on. Sometimes it idles smooth as a top and sometimes it feels like the doors might fall off. The worst part for me is this buzzing sound it makes when acting up. When I get up around 2000 rpm it buzzes really annoyingly loud; I think the sound is coming from the passenger side by the windshield. I have replaced the a/c compressor on the last two trucks I've owned and I want to put this one off as long as possible as these 4.6 compressors are a major pain in the ***. Is there something in the cab I can tighten to make that buzzing sound stop? Its driving me CRAZY especially since I JUST BOUGHT the dang thing.
#2
I would clean the throttle body, MAF, and replace the fuel filter. Then do the idle relearn process to see if that clears up your shaking at idle
The buzzing might a loose piece of trim or maybe one of your pulleys is starting to go out. have someone rev it up and try to pinpoint where it is coming from
